Types of Insulation Adhesive Tapes

One category of insulation adhesive tapes commonly used in various industries is PVC (Polyvinyl chloride) tape. PVC tape offers good electrical insulation properties and is resistant to moisture, UV rays, and chemicals. It is often utilized in electrical applications to provide insulation and protection to wires and cables. The flexibility and durability of PVC tape make it a popular choice for securing and bundling cables in both indoor and outdoor environments.

Another type of insulation adhesive tape is the rubber-based tape, which is known for its high-temperature resistance and conformability. Rubber tapes are commonly used for splicing and insulating wires, as well as for sealing and protecting electrical connections. The self-fusing property of rubber tape allows it to create a strong, moisture-resistant seal when wrapped around an object. This type of tape is favored in applications where a tight, long-lasting seal is crucial to prevent potential electrical hazards.

Key Applications of Insulation Adhesive Tapes

One significant application of insulation adhesive tapes is in the electrical market. These tapes are crucial for insulating and protecting electrical components, wires, and cables from moisture, dust, and other external factors. By providing a secure and reliable insulation solution, these tapes help ensure the safety and efficiency of electrical systems, reducing the risk of short circuits or electrical malfunctions.

Another key area where insulation adhesive tapes find extensive use is in the construction sector. These tapes are widely employed for joining insulation materials, such as foam boards or fiberglass, creating airtight seals, and enhancing the overall thermal efficiency of buildings. Additionally, insulation adhesive tapes play a vital role in HVAC systems by sealing ductwork and preventing air leaks, thereby improving energy efficiency and reducing heating and cooling costs for commercial and residential buildings.

Regulatory Standards for Insulation Adhesive Tapes

Adherence to regulatory standards is paramount in the manufacturing and use of insulation adhesive tapes. These standards ensure the safety and efficacy of the products, protecting both consumers and the environment. Various regulatory bodies, such as ASTM International and UL (Underwriter Laboratories), have set guidelines regarding the composition, performance, and labeling requirements for insulation adhesive tapes. Manufacturers are expected to comply with these standards to ensure the quality and reliability of their products in the market.

Regulatory standards for insulation adhesive tapes encompass a wide range of factors, including flame resistance, temperature resistance, and electrical insulation properties. It is essential for manufacturers to conduct thorough testing and certification processes to meet these standards before their products can be introduced to the market. By adhering to these regulations, companies demonstrate their commitment to producing high-quality insulation adhesive tapes that meet the necessary safety and performance criteria.

Strategies for Choosing the Right Insulation Adhesive Tape for Your Project

When choosing the right insulation adhesive tape for your project, it is crucial to consider the specific requirements of the application. Different tapes offer varying levels of temperature resistance, adhesion strength, and flexibility, so assessing these factors in relation to your project's needs is paramount. Conducting a thorough evaluation of the environmental conditions the tape will be exposed to, such as humidity levels and potential chemical exposure, will aid in selecting a tape that can withstand these challenges effectively.

Furthermore, it is essential to take into account the surface compatibility of the insulation adhesive tape with the materials it will be adhered to. Some tapes are designed for use on specific surfaces, such as metals, plastics, or fabrics, and using an incompatible tape may lead to poor adhesion and subpar performance. Consulting with manufacturers or experts in the field can provide valuable insights into which tape will offer optimal adhesion and longevity for your particular project requirements.
